Electronic commerce and payments leader First Data Corp. has announced that its healthcare services unit has been certified by Discover Financial Services to process general acceptance healthcare transactions on the Discover Network.


By providing certification to First Data Healthcare Services, Discover Network expects to broaden the agreement for future testing and certification of additional processing functionality, which will further enhance the consumer’s experience when using a Discover Network employee benefit card to access qualified tax advantaged healthcare, dependant care, and transit accounts.


“Discover has been an important business partner with First Data for many years, and we are very excited to reach this milestone achievement,” said Beverly Kennedy, president, First Data Healthcare Services. “With the addition of Discover, First Data can now support healthcare card processing on each of the major networks.”


“Supporting financial transactions in the consumer directed healthcare arena is an important initiative for Discover Network,” said Joe Hurley, vice president of Discover Network Strategic Development for Discover Financial Services. “This certification underscores our efforts to bring the most advanced, inventive solutions to market.”


First Data will begin processing healthcare transactions for Discover Network by 2007.
